About the Course
The Advanced Certificate Course in Management of Addictive Disorders (ACCMAD 6.0) is designed to democratize knowledge and build capacity in addiction medicine. Our mission is to ensure the right care, at the right place, at the right time.
What is NIMHANS ECHO?
The "Hub and Spoke" model links an interprofessional specialist team at NIMHANS academic centre of expertise (the Hub) with healthcare providers (spokes). Each NIMHANS tele-ECHO session consists of speaker-led presentations of anonymized patient cases and discussion of the cases, whereby the peers as well as hub experts provide advice on diagnosis and management.
⭐ The Heart of This Programme
Case discussion by participants with guided practice by Hub is the "Soul" of this programme.
36 learners will present complex cases in weekly sessions, receiving feedback from experts and peers.

Course Modules
Module I: Introduction
Evaluation of patients with SUD, diagnostic criteria, neurobiology of addiction, and assessment tools
Module II: Alcohol Use Disorders
Comprehensive coverage of alcohol pharmacology, withdrawal management, neuropsychiatric complications, and evidence-based pharmacological interventions
Module III: Opioid Use Disorders
Opioid pharmacology, overdose management, Opioid Substitution Therapy (OST) including Buprenorphine and Methadone Maintenance Treatment
Module IV: Cannabis Use Disorders
Natural to synthetic cannabinoids, treatment options, cannabis and psychosis, medical cannabis
Module V: Sedatives & Solvents
Benzodiazepine pharmacology, dependence management, volatile solvent abuse, and adolescent addiction
Module VI: Stimulants
Cocaine, amphetamine-type stimulants, mechanisms of harm, and evidence-based treatment approaches
Module VII: Emerging Areas
Comorbidity management, behavioral addictions (pathological gambling, internet gaming disorder), research in addiction psychiatry, ADHD and SUD
